As a private organization, the Boy Scouts of America is the sole arbiter of whether it will issue a charter to any organi-zation. In signing an annual charter agreement with the local council, the organization agrees (among other things) to follow BSA rules, regulations and policies; maintain and support a unit committee made up of at least three persons for each unit; and ensure appropriate facilities for regular unit meetings. A chartered organization is a community-based group whose objectives, mission and methodologies are compatible with those of the BSA. In general, the assets of the unit belong to the Chartered Organization, however, this is based on the facts and circumstances including state law, donor restrictions, funding sources, and legal title.
